WebJun 27, 2012 · 4. A change in the direction in which the Earth rotates would cause a heap of changes. The magnetic field (or the geomagnetic field) generated by the motion of the molten iron alloys in the Earth's outer core would flip poles, meaning the magnetic north pole and the magnetic south pole would 'switch'. WebOct 26, 2024 · Answer: The planets of our solar system orbit the Sun in a counterclockwise direction (when viewed from above the Sun’s north pole) because of the way our solar system formed.
